How Best Photo Spots In San Diego Actually Work San Diego’s most compelling photo locations blend accessibility with distinctive character. From the sweeping coastal views at Torrey Pines State Reserve—where rolling dunes and ocean glint under a bright sky—to the moody backstreets of North Park with their eclectic murals, each space offers a unique visual language. These spots thrive on natural light, strong composition potential, and cultural authenticity—factors underlying their viral presence in lifestyle and travel content.

Understanding the mechanics means recognizing that great photography here depends on timing, environment, and perspective. Mornings bring soft, golden light ideal for shoreline shots, while overcast days soften shadows in historic districts. Common Questions About Best Photo Spots In San Diego

Q: Where does the best light for photography occur? The golden hours—early morning and late afternoon—maximize natural warmth and reduce harsh contrast, especially along the coast and in shaded urban areas.

Q: Are there free spots, or do I need to pay to access prime views? Many top locations are public and free, though parking in central areas can require planning. Avoid private or restricted zones by sticking to well-marked, permitted access points.

Q: How can I capture compelling shots without heavy gear? Smartphone cameras deliver excellent image quality with proper framing, natural lighting, and basic composition techniques like the rule of thirds.
